Date Paid price Annual growth After inflation Dec 2023 £300,000 0.0% -3.5% Sep 2017 £300,000 * 4.8% 2.5% Nov 2007 £190,000 3.3% 0.8% Nov 2004 New build New £172,500 na na *This price paid record has been flagged by Land Registry as a 'Category B: Additional Price Paid entry'. This could be due to a variety of reasons, such as the sale being a buy-to-let purchase, a repossession or a transfer to a limited company. When Land Registry suspects that a sale does not reflect full market value (e.g. part-ownership or right to buy), these transactions can be flagged as well. For this reason, we exclude them from our area statistics.
